These are sponsored by nationwide and local companies in both electronic-, Internet-, and paper-based layouts. In 2003, there were 787 daily papers and 680 evening papers in the United States. In large urban territories, numerous daily papers also release a condensed everyday variation of their print magazine that has a tendency to concentrate much more on neighborhood news and is cost-free to the public.


If the information and editorial departments are different within a newspaper, there might additionally be a content web page editor that is responsible for editorials, viewpoint columns, and letters-to-the-editor. A taking care of editor supervises the daily tasks of the news department. Other editorssuch as national, state, functions, and image editorsare focused on their divisions and oversight, and report to the managing editor.


In 2003, there were 6,704 regular papers in the United States. Weekly papers (also called "weeklies") usually cover smaller geographical locations than day-to-day newspapers, or are released as "alternatives" to everyday magazines.


Monthly newspapers are usually totally free, and usually serve a particular geographical area with information, features, and editorials that are targeted to that neighborhood. They are a terrific source for advertising activities or events within a certain neighborhood, as their viewers live within and often take individual passion in the area in which they are published.

Similar to newspapers, tv supplies a broad array of public and victim awareness chances: Tv news can be international, nationwide, and/or neighborhood in scope. Regional experts are typically looked for to make news or function tales much more pertinent to a community.


Some television news programs have editorial sectors in which community leaders or speakers talk about the information of the day or issues that are of passion to the station's customers. Numerous tv terminals consist of "area schedules" in their newscasts and on their Website that offer info concerning area tasks.


Trick tv terminal employees that are in charge of news and community connections include The (likewise called "terminal supervisor") is accountable for managing all terminal operations. The identifies the most essential problems and information that a terminal will cover. He or she will establish priorities, designate press reporters to cover stories, and take care of logistics such as online insurance coverage or satellite feeds.

There are 13,261 radio stations in the United States, consisting of 4,811 industrial AM stations, 6,147 business FM terminals, and 2,303 instructional stations. The format of radio stations differs: their primary emphasis can be news, talk, music, or a combination.

Wire solutions are wire service that provide news records, functions, and human rate of interest tales to both print and program news media. The significant cable services click for source host Internet site with contact details for submitting press launches or concepts for stories, and some have local bureaus in significant cities that focus more on state and local news.


Making use of Online blog sites is likewise boosting. A blog site (acronym for "Weblog") is a journal or diary that is published online for seeing by the public. A blog contains a continuous collection of access that are created from the most recent to the oldest. Blogs are opinion-oriented and give authors with the possibility to discuss themselves and their very own experiences, current social or political problems, and/or react to current occasions current.
